Utah Has More Than 800 Cases; Small Business Loans Announced
Current cases: Utah’s confirmed cases of COVID-19 increased by 90 on Monday after more than 2,000 additional tests were completed, for a total of 806. Two additional deaths have also been reported. As with previous days, nearly half of the new confirmed cases (41) were in Salt Lake County. Other local health departments reporting new cases include Bear River (4), Davis (6), San Juan (2), Southwest Utah (1), Summit (16), Utah (7), Wasatch (5), and Weber-Morgan (2). GOED loans: Because of the recent COVID-19 pandemic, the Utah Governor’s Office of Economic announces a plan to help Utah small business owners. The Utah Leads Together Small Business Bridge Loan program offers a bridge loan to the state’s small businesses with 50 or fewer employees.
The program is available beginning March 31, 2020, at 8 a.m. (MDT). You can learn more about the loans in this blog post.
